Obituary for Michael Wayne Baker Reverend Michael Wayne Baker, age 64, a resident of Park Hills, Missouri, passed away Tuesday, May 22, 2018 in Park Hills. Michael was born July 28, 1953, in Batesville, Arkansas and he was the son of the late Faye Reynolds Baker and Fred W. Baker. Michael was a Veteran of the U. S. Navy. Survivors include his wife, Pam Baker, his children, Danny Baker and his wife Heather, Jeremy Baker and his fiancé, Kim Holland, Mandy Linnemann and her husband Ryan and Kayla Bell and her husband Matthew, his grandchildren, Mikayla Fueshko, Megan Linneman, Taylor Linneman, Brody Linneman, Regan Baker, Jaila Rhinehart, Kyndal Baker, Keegan Baker and Junia Bell, his siblings, James Baker and his wife Shirlee, Jenny Davis, Debbie Stark and her husband Ray, Fredeline Roberts and numerous nieces and nephews also survive. The Remembrance of Life Service was conducted on Saturday, May 26, 2018 from the Horton-Wampler Funeral Home in Park Hills, Missouri. Reverend Danny Hartley and Reverend Thomas Powell officiated the service. Graveside Services and Interment will be conducted, Thursday, May 31, 2018 at 11:00 A. M. from the Chattanooga National Cemetery. Military Honors will be given. The Jim Rush Funeral and Cremation Services North Ocoee Chapel has charge of local arrangements.
